    OK my husband does not think this pic actually was taken without being doctored up. What do you say? Did you take the pic? I say it is true but he is a doubter. Help me out and let me know. Thanks
    The photos aren't doctored, BUT... they aren't big horned sheep and it isn't Montana. :(

    Snopes.com came to the rescue again (http://www.snopes.com/photos/animals/buffalobill.asp) -- They're actually alpine ibex and they're crossing the Diga del Cingino (the Cingino Dam) in Northern Italy.

    Still pretty remarkable, though....
